SunStat Command Thermostat
Floor sensor
Screwdriver
Installation manual
2 machine screws
5 wire nuts
Items Needed
Electrical box (must be UL Listed and proper size)
Wire nuts (must be UL Listed and proper size)
Flexible or rigid conduit (if required, must be UL Listed and proper size)
12-guage or 14-guage electrical wiring cable (UL Listed)
Nail plate
Hot glue gun and hot glue
Location
Thermostat is designed for indoor dry location only.
Do not install where there is a draft, direct sun, hot-water piping, ducting or other cause for inaccurate
temperature readings.
Do not install where there is electrical interference from equipment, appliances, or other sources.
Install away from all water sources such as sinks and at least 4′ (1.2 m) away from showers and bathtubs.
Consider easy access for wiring, viewing, and adjusting.
Install at a suitable height, normally about 4-1/2′ to 5′ (1.4 m to 1.5 m) from the floor.
Specifications:
Power supply: 120/240 V (ac), 60 Hz, 3 watts
Maximum load : 15 amps, resistive
Maximum power : 1800 watts at 120 VAC
3600 watts at 240 VAC
GFCI: Class A (5 milliamp trip)
Approvals: UL 943, UL 873, UL 991, FCC Meets Class B: ICES-003 & FCC Part 15B
